# 将Python转换为YAML的流程
## 1. 概述
在本文中,我将向你介绍如何将Python对象转换为YAML格式。YAML是一种人类可读性高的数据序列化语言,它被广泛用于配置文件和数据传输。在Python中,我们可以使用PyYAML库来实现Python到YAML的转换。
## 2. 流程图
下面是将Python转换为YAML的流程图:
```mermaid
flowchart TD
原创
2023-09-12 03:22:08
425阅读
# Python中如何将整数转换为二进制
在编程的过程中,数据需要以不同的形式进行表示,其中二进制表示法是最基础的方式之一。在Python中,将一个整数转换为二进制非常简单,今天我将向你介绍如何实现这一过程。我们将通过一个清晰的流程、代码示例和相关的数据可视化帮助你更好地理解。
## 1. 实现流程
以下是将一个整数转换为二进制的基本步骤:
| 步骤 | 描述
原创
2024-08-30 03:58:03
147阅读
一、参考链接https://pyyaml.org/wiki/PyYAMLDocumentation二、python类型转换为yaml# -*- coding: utf-8 -*- # @Time : 2022/1/2 21:53 # @Author : lujunxian # @File : test_yaml.pyimport yamlclass TestYaml(): with
原创
2023-01-10 14:31:15
479阅读
点赞
1评论
JavaScript一共有7中数据类型:简单数据类型:number,string,boolean,underfine,null,以及ES6 新加的symbol和复杂数据类型object。symbol这里暂时不做探讨,null和undefined如果需要用到直接var a = null/var a = undefined 更方便,所以平时我们经常用到的是number,string,Boolean,o
转载
2023-06-08 14:47:27
273阅读
# 从Curl转换为Python代码:轻松实现API请求
在网络开发中,使用API(应用程序编程接口)进行数据交互是十分常见的做法。而Curl(客户端URL)是一个用于通过命令行发送HTTP请求的工具,对于开发者来说,它是测试API的有力助手。然而,不同编程语言对HTTP请求的支持有所不同,许多开发者希望能将Curl命令轻松转换为Python代码。本文将带你了解如何将Curl命令转换为Pytho
# 将列表转换为Java对象的科普文章
当我们在开发Java应用程序时,处理数据对象是我们必不可少的工作。尤其是在面对从数据库、外部API或者其他数据源获取的数据时,常常会将数据存放在一个包含多个元素的列表(List)中。本文将简单介绍如何将List中的数据转换为Java对象,以便我们能够更方便地操作和使用这些数据。
## 1. Java对象的定义
在Java中,创建一个对象通常需要定义一个
spring报错: No converter found for return value of type: class java.util.ArrayList spring是没有将ArrayList转换成json的转换器的,需要导入json依赖。<!--jackson依赖-->
<dependency>
<groupId>com.faste
转载
2023-06-08 00:13:54
220阅读
存储过程简介什么是存储过程:存储过程可以说是一个记录集吧,它是由一些T-SQL语句组成的代码块,这些T-SQL语句代码像一个方法一样实现一些功能(对单表或多表的增删改查),然后再给这个代码块取一个名字,在用到这个功能的时候调用他就行了。存储过程的好处:1.由于数据库执行动作时,是先编译后执行的。然而存储过程是一个编译过的代码块,所以执行效率要比T-SQL语句高。2.一个存储过程在程序在网络中交互时
# Markdown文件转换为Kubernetes YAML
在Kubernetes中,YAML(YAML Ain't Markup Language)是一种常见的配置语言,用于定义和部署应用程序和服务。然而,手动编写复杂的YAML文件可能会很繁琐和容易出错。有幸的是,我们可以使用Markdown文件来简化这个过程,并将其转换为Kubernetes YAML。
## Markdown和YAML
原创
2024-01-08 12:54:43
145阅读
IO(Input Output)流 IO流用来处理设备之间的数据传输 Java对数据的操作是通过流的方式 Java用于操作流的对象都在IO包中 流按操作数据分为两种:字节流与字符流 。 流按流向分为:输入流,输出流。 IO流常用基类 字节流的抽象基类: • InputStream ,OutputStream。 字符流的抽象基类: • Reader , Writer。
# 将Java Bean转换为YAML
在Java编程中,我们经常需要将Java对象转换为不同的格式,如JSON、YAML等。在本文中,我们将重点介绍如何将Java Bean对象转换为YAML格式。YAML是一种轻量级的数据序列化格式,易于阅读和编写,常用于配置文件等场景。
## 什么是Java Bean?
Java Bean是一种符合特定规范的Java类,用于存储数据并提供对数据的访问和操
原创
2024-04-16 05:32:43
64阅读
在Python中,我们可以使用split()方法来将字符串转换为列表。默认情况下,split()方法会根据空格将字符串分割成多个子字符串,并将它们存储在一个列表中。但是,如果字符串本身包含空格,那么split()方法就无法正确地将字符串分割成想要的子字符串。
为了解决这个问题,我们可以使用引号(单引号或双引号)将包含空格的字符串括起来,以避免split()方法将其视为多个子字符串。例如,我们可以
原创
2023-09-23 18:03:33
58阅读
# Android编程中转换为二进制的实现
## 概述
在Android编程中,经常需要将数据转换为二进制的形式,以便进行存储、传输或其他处理。本文将向刚入行的小白介绍如何在Android中实现将数据转换为二进制的过程。首先,我将简要介绍整个流程,并用表格展示每个步骤。然后,我将逐步解释每个步骤应该如何实现,包括所需的代码和注释。
## 流程图
```mermaid
classDiagram
原创
2023-12-02 03:35:45
175阅读
作者:布加迪
原文
:
https://developer.51cto.com/art/201910/604745.htm
众所周知,JSON让开发人员易于使用,又让机器易于解析和生成。
JSON吸引了工具构建者的注意,他们开发了用于重新格式化、验证和解析JSON的众多工具,这不足为奇。这些工具既有在Web浏览器中运行的在线使用程序,又有面向代码
转载
2024-08-28 22:10:32
0阅读
数据转换是开发过程中最常碰到的问题之一,今天来浅记录一下。字符串转整数方法一:parseInt()该方法参数为字符串,结果是字符串转换而来的整数。如果字符串的首字符不是一个数字则转换失败,返回NaN,否则一直转换到字符串中第一个不是数字的字符为止。 parseInt() 还可以有第二个参数,表示待转换字符串的进制。示例:parseInt("12");
parseInt("12.2");
p
转载
2023-08-20 22:13:22
186阅读
## Java 将时间中转换为带T
在Java中,时间格式经常需要进行转换,特别是在不同系统或数据格式之间传递时间时。一种常见的时间格式是带有字母"T"的ISO 8601格式,例如`2022-01-15T13:30:00`。本文将介绍如何在Java中将时间中转换为带有"T"的格式。
### 使用`DateTimeFormatter`类
Java 8提供了`DateTimeFormatter`
原创
2024-05-06 04:15:29
291阅读
Python实现十进制和二进制、八进制、十六进制的相互转换1. 前言2. 实现思想2.1 十进制转换为其他进制2.2 其他进制转换为十进制3. 参考资料 1. 前言此文方便后期的复习,如果有问题,欢迎批评指正。2. 实现思想2.1 十进制转换为其他进制原理:除以进制数(base)取余,逆序输出。 举例:将16转换为2进制形式16除以2取余,得到余数0,存入结果(这个是最低位,将16//2 得到8
转载
2023-09-26 11:49:28
125阅读
在现代软件开发中,JSON 和 YAML 是常用的数据交换格式。很多时候,我们需要将 YAML 格式的数据转换为 JSON 格式,以便于处理和传输。本文将详细介绍如何在 Java 中实现 YAML 转换为 JSON 格式的功能,包括背景描述、技术原理、架构解析、源码分析、应用场景和案例分析等多个方面。
我们将使用一些流行的库,例如 SnakeYAML 和 Jackson,来实现这个任务。接下来,
properties与yml的区别properties是@Value yml是@ConfigurationProperties赋值比较@Value这个使用起来并不友好!我们需要为每个属性单独注解赋值,比较麻烦;我们来看个功能对比图1、@ConfigurationProperties只需要写一次即可 , @Value则需要每个字段都添加2、松散绑定:这个什么意思呢? 比如我的yml中写的l
转载
2024-02-27 07:14:05
78阅读
Python基础知识之集合一 概念及其创建方式概念:创建方式:二 增删改操作增删三 集合之间的判断及其关系判断:关系四 集合的无序性 一 概念及其创建方式概念:集合也是Python中的一种内置数据结构,和字典,列表一样(可进行 增删改 操作) 集合是没有 value 的字典创建方式:第一种 { }: 代码举例:a = {1,2,3,4,12,32}其中,参数不能重复,否则只输出一个 集合的元素具
转载
2023-08-10 09:57:16
116阅读